Phil says : "Openness" is something I take so seriously that it's in the name (OPTIMAES). That's why I use and believe in wiki as the main vehicle for discussion. Anyone can edit it, and I trust you to, too. But there are some house rules which I, as editor, will be enforcing. I invite you to follow them, and to enforce them too. * The most important thing to realize is that Criticism is welcome. I believe that criticism is good. A certain amount of conflict is good. And consensus is a symptom of epistemic exhaustion (WeArePartisan). However some kinds of criticism are better than others. See WeNeedYourCriticism to understand which. * Spamming is out. Adverts and other irrelevant stuff will be removed. * Personal insults? I don't mind being personally insulted if it's a) relevant, and b) witty or makes a valid point in a concise way. But everyone has the right to remove insults against them. * Removing stuff you don't agree with? Don't do it. If you don't agree, post a criticism or counter-argument. If it's a troll, refactor it to the TrollBin. * Intellectual Property : All OPTIMAES code is released under the GnuGeneralPublicLicense. If you write your own code from scratch you can release it under any license you like. But everything you write here is presumed to be in the public domain as defined by the CreativeCommons? license. That, by the way, is a legal requirement, for posting here. If you can't legally post the text under CC license, you aren't allowed to post it here. * OTOH if you find a violation of your intellectual property here you can delete it yourself. |
